Show HN: Paste a song and get 5 license-free cousins that sound like it

https://mockfreeli.org/
1•ianhil•44m ago
I make youtube videos for fun occasionally. Finding license free music without paying a subscription is a PITA. Free tools make you search by name, tags, etc. and surface music that never fits what I'm looking for.

I built mockfreeli.org to find license-free music that sounds like the song you want. It's free, all you do is find a youtube video to the song you want, paste the link in mockfreeli, and it'll find five of the closest-related, license-free cousins from the corpus.

The corpus it searches is 38k songs from youtube audio library, no copyright sounds, and the internet archive, heavily refined to exclude rips, covers, or anything that requires licensing. The primary relational algorithm is MuQ-MuLan with metadata, BPM, and key as secondary search criteria. It runs on a mac mini with an rpi 5 as fallback. Consequently, searches take about 10s on the mini to about 30s on the rpi.
